History and Growth:
Online poker emerged in late 1990s due to advancements in technology together with internet. The very first internet poker room, Planet Poker, was launched in 1998, attracting a little but enthusiastic neighborhood. But was at early 2000s that online poker practiced exponential growth, mainly because of the introduction of real-money games and televised poker tournaments.
